Output f838d2152393d661f4f3b3bd3300fdcac68a90cfd47fb66f18fa3a621c828b85:1

value
584957727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a3c91fcd5102e84a5eb3447b2141f8f9e3f8a7 OP_EQUAL
address
35aUWdHq3ghJC5noSuG7X3tLEQwxKmK4eK
transaction
f838d2152393d661f4f3b3bd3300fdcac68a90cfd47fb66f18fa3a621c828b85
spent
true